Considering your specific power needs and budget will help narrow down the best options for your winter outings.Capacity and Power Output
Capacity, measured in amp-hours (Ah), directly affects how long your battery can supply power during winter camping. Larger capacities, such as 100Ah or more, support extended usage, but they also add weight and size. Power output, rated in watts, determines what appliances or devices you can run simultaneously. Matching your energy needs with a battery that provides enough capacity and sufficient wattage ensures your gear stays powered without overpaying for unused capacity.
Low-Temperature Performance
Cold weather can drastically reduce a battery’s efficiency, leading to shorter runtimes or failure to start. Batteries with built-in low-temp protection or self-heating features are vital for winter camping. Self-heating batteries actively warm themselves in cold conditions, maintaining performance and extending battery life. Without these features, batteries risk capacity loss or damage, making it a key factor to prioritize in your selection process.
Portability and Size
If you plan to move your battery around frequently or pack light, size and weight become critical considerations. Smaller, lighter batteries with high energy density can fit easily into backpacks or tight spaces. Conversely, larger batteries with higher capacity are better suited for stationary setups like RVs. Evaluate your mobility needs and storage capacity to choose a battery that balances weight with power capability.
Safety and Monitoring Features
Reliable safety features such as built-in BMS (Battery Management System), over-voltage, over-current, and low-temp protections are essential for winter use. Monitoring tools like Bluetooth or touchscreen displays allow real-time status updates, helping prevent unexpected failures. While these features often come with a higher upfront cost, they can save money and hassle by reducing the risk of damage and ensuring safe operation in cold environments.
Cost and Longevity
Higher-quality batteries with advanced features typically cost more but offer longer cycle life and better durability. A long cycle count, such as 5000+ cycles, indicates a longer lifespan, which can justify a higher initial investment over time. Balancing cost with expected longevity and features will help you find a solution that offers good value and dependable performance through multiple winter seasons.
Frequently Asked Questions
Can I use a regular LiFePO4 battery for winter camping?
Using a standard LiFePO4 battery without any cold-weather features can lead to reduced performance or damage in freezing temperatures. These batteries lack self-heating or low-temp protection, risking capacity loss or failure. For winter camping, it’s better to choose a model specifically designed for cold conditions, which can operate reliably and safely even in sub-zero environments.
How does self-heating in a LiFePO4 battery work?
Self-heating batteries incorporate a built-in heating element that activates when temperatures drop below a certain threshold. This feature keeps the internal chemistry at an optimal operating temperature, maintaining capacity and efficiency. While self-heating consumes additional energy, it significantly extends usable runtime in winter conditions, making it a valuable feature for cold-weather camping.
What size battery should I choose for a weekend winter camping trip?
For short trips like weekends, a 50Ah to 100Ah battery often provides enough power to run essential devices and small appliances without excessive weight. If you plan to run more or larger equipment, larger capacities may be necessary. Consider your total energy needs, and aim for a balance between sufficient runtime and portability to avoid unnecessary bulk.
Are portable power stations better than traditional batteries for winter camping?
Portable power stations with integrated LiFePO4 batteries often include features like AC outlets, USB ports, and surge protection, adding convenience. They are generally easier to handle and can be used for multiple purposes, including as an emergency backup. However, they tend to be more expensive and heavier than standalone batteries, so if portability and simplicity are priorities, smaller batteries might be a better choice.
How long does a high-quality LiFePO4 battery last in winter conditions?
High-quality LiFePO4 batteries with proper low-temp protection can last for thousands of cycles, often exceeding 5000 cycles, even in cold conditions. Their lifespan depends on usage, maintenance, and operating environment. Regularly monitoring capacity and avoiding over-discharge will help maximize their longevity through many winter seasons.
